Quamir vs Quan

American parents have registered 1,464 Quans since 1880, against 663 Quamirs. But in 2025 it was Quamir that was commoner, 34 babies to 12.

Which name is older

Half of the Quans alive today are over 30; half the Quamirs are over 16. That is 14 years between them: two names in use at the same time, worn by two different generations.
